done and this is how the Velsicol Chemical site in St. Louis Michigan was discovered.

There are numerous similarities with our Chemtura site here in Elmira. DDT was manufactured there as well as here. The contamination goes very deep into the ground as well as into the local river directly beside the site. DNAPLS have been found on both sites and require remediation.
